假定英语课上老师要求同桌之间交换修改作文,请你修改你同桌写的以下作文。文中共有10处错误,每句中最多有两处。错误涉及一个单词的增加、删除或修改。

增加:在缺词处加一个漏字符号(Λ),并在其下面写出该加的词。

删除:把多余的词用斜线(\)划掉。

修改:在错的词下划一横线,并在该词下面写出修改后的词。

注意:1. 每处错误及其修改均仅限一词;

2. 只允许修改10处,多者(从第11处起)不计分。

Last month, I had a unpleasant holiday. Having visited the Australian mainland before, I planned to going to the Solomon Islands. With my disappointment, the guide cut my holiday shortly by 2 days. He also sent me to the same places I had visited them the year before. In addition, the holiday I go on included none of the activities mentioned in the travel plan. To make matters bad, I had to share a double room with someone I did not know, despite the fact I had paid for a single room. Last but not least, my luggages arrived a week late because of the delay causes by the travel agency.

 

①a错误,改为an ②going错误,改为go ③With错误,改为To ④shortly错误,改为short ⑤去掉them ⑥go 错误,改为went ⑦bad错误,改为worse ⑧fact后加that ⑨luggages错误,改为luggage ⑩causes错误,改为caused 【解析】 本文是一篇记叙文。作者介绍自己一次不愉快的假日旅行。 1.考查不定冠词。单词unpleasant是以元音因素开头,用an表示“一”,故把a改为an。 2.固定搭配。plan to do sth.计划做某事,故把going改为go。 3.考查固定词组。to one’s disappointment使某人失望的是,故把with改为To。 4.考查固定词组。cut short缩短,缩减,故把shortly改为short。 5.考查定语从句。句意:他还把我送到了我去年去过的地方。此处places是先行词,在后面的定语从句中做宾语,所以定语从句中不能出现宾语,故把them去掉。 6.考查时态。根据上文的Last month,说明句子用一般过去时态,故把go 改为went。 7.考查固定结构。To make matters worse使事情更糟糕的是,故把bad改成worse。 8.考查同位语从句。句意:我不知道,尽管我已经付了一间单人房的钱。the fact后面的I had paid for a single room.是fact的具体内容,所以在fact后加that引出同位语从句。 9.考查不可数名词。此处luggage(行李)是不可数名词,没有复数形式,故把luggages改为luggage。 10.考查过去分词做后置定语。句意:最后但并非最不重要的是,由于旅行社的延误,我的行李晚了一个星期。此处delay 和cause之间是被动关系,所以是过去分词做后置定语,故把causes改为caused。

The world’s first robot police officer has started working. Its name is ‘RoboCop’ and it went into service for the Dubai Police earlier this week. Robocop’s first official duty was to greet guests at the opening of a security conference in Dubai. Apart from greeting visitors’ its job was to answer questions and give directions. RoboCop has a built — in tablet for people to interact with. People can use the tablet to pay traffic fines and use other smart police services. The tablet is linked to a police station, so people can talk to human police officers. In addition, RoboCop can speak six languages, including English and Arabic. The 170 - centimetre - tall robot can also shake hands, salute people and recognize people’s emotions and facial expressions.

Dubai Police says RoboCop is the first of many robot police officers for the city. A spokesman said that by 2030, 25 per cent of the Dubai Police force will be robots. He said: “We are looking to make everything smart in Dubai Police. By 2030, we will have the first smart police station which won’t require human employees.”

“The RoboCop is the latest smart addition to the police force and has been designed to help us fight crime, keep the city safe and improve happiness levels,” He added. He also said that RoboCop would, “assist and help people in the malls or on the streets”. An official at the security conference commented that the future is here now, saying: “The age of the robots is no longer coming. It has arrived.”

A serious problem for today’s society is who should be responsible for our elderly and how to improve their lives. It is not only a financial problem but also a question of the system we want for our society. I would like to suggest several possible solutions to this problem.

First, employers should take the responsibility for their retired employees. To make this possible, a percentage of profits should be set aside for this purpose. But when a company must take life-long responsibility for its employees, it may suffer from a commercial disadvantage due to higher employee costs.

Another way of solving the problem is to return the responsibility to the individual. This means each person must save during his working years to pay for his years of retirement. This does not seem a very fair model since some people have enough trouble paying for their daily life without trying to earn extra to cover their retirement years. This means the government might have to step in to care for the poor.

In addition, the government could take responsibility for the care of the elderly. This could be financed through government taxes to increase the level of pensions. Furthermore, some institutions should be created for senior citizens, which can help provide a comfortable life for them. Unfortunately, as the present situation in our country shows, this is not a truly viable answer. The government can seldom afford to care for the elderly, particularly when it is busy trying to care for the young.

One further solution is that the government or social organizations establish some working places especially for the elderly where they are independent.

To sum up, all these options have advantages and disadvantages. Therefore, it is reasonable to expect that some combination of these options may be needed to provide the care we hope to give to our elderly generations.
